Title: Studies on the asparagine-linked oligosaccharides from cartilage-specific proteoglycan

Chondrocytes synthesize and secrete a cartilage-specific proteoglycan (PG-H) as one of their major products. This proteoglycan has attached to it several types of carbohydrate chains, including chondroitin sulfate, keratan sulfate, O-linked oligosaccharides, and asparagine-linked oligosaccharides. The asparagine-linked oligosaccharides found on PG-H were investigated in these studies. Methodology was developed for the isolation and separation of standard of standard complex and high mannose type oligosaccharides. This included digesting glycoproteins with N-glycanase and separation of the oligosaccharides according to type by concanavalin-A lectin chromatography. The different oligosaccharide types were then analyzed by high pressure liquid chromatography. This methodology was used in the subsequent studies on the PG-H asparagine-linked oligosaccharides. Initially, the asparagine-linked oligosaccharides recovered from the culture medium (CM) and cell-associated (Ma) fractions of PG-H from of tibial chondrocytes were labeled with (/sup 3/H)-mannose and the oligosaccharides were isolated and analyzed.
